Output 86bdc41ac05e682974ec67320d0df19522c4a60fb087aa03ea43f1b5586fb97e:0

value
1303080305
script pubkey
OP_0 OP_PUSHBYTES_20 81f3fa666105919eeb07cf2ea3d624bf0e9bf7f9
address
ltc1qs8el5enpqkgea6c8euh2843yhu8fhalehnaeag
transaction
86bdc41ac05e682974ec67320d0df19522c4a60fb087aa03ea43f1b5586fb97e
spent
true